Job Description
Serves as a brand ambassador, enlivening the institution's and department's mission, vision, values, and service standards.
Guides consumers through their experience, providing information about services, hours of operation, and highlighting features, events, and engagement tools.
Affords assistance in scheduling appointments and maintains knowledge of scheduling policies and procedures.
Confirms patient demographics and account information is accurate and completed before visit.
Supports in the execution of experiences and meets or exceeds consumer needs, demonstrating a sense of urgency to recover any service gaps.
Interacts with all consumers and team members using the prescribed communication model.
Speaks and writes using clear and professional language, demonstrating age-specific communication skills for consumers with the ability to assess and interpret relevant data.
Maintains working knowledge of scheduling systems, authorizations/pre-certifications, and benefit memos to meet and exceed consumer expectations.
Promotes expeditious billing and protects the financial standing of the institution, facilitating patient connections to billing services.
Maintains understanding of patient accounts to ensure expeditious billing and protect the financial standing of the institution, facilitating patient connections to billing services.
